Have you worked on application development projects, if so what technologies have you used, and what was your specific role on those projects?
Application development is a broad set of technologies, and it can apply to building applications using tools from several software brands. There are typically two categories of technologies within application development. The first is client-side scripting/coding using technologies such as HTML, JavaScript, jQuery, etc. The second is Server side scripting/coding using technologies such as PHP, ASP (Microsoft), Cold Fusion, Python, etc. The reason a hiring manager at NetLight Consulting AB would ask this question is to see which category you fall under. They want to know if you're qualified to do both. Most consultants who have spent considerable time consulting on application development projects should have a solid working knowledge of both. The hiring manager might also ask about the application development lifecycle which is now more geared toward web application development. Almost all applications nowadays will be developed for the web. When you answer these questions, make sure you understand what they are asking before giving a full explanation.
